What is Voice Over?
Voice over refers to the technique of using a voice that is not part of the narrative in various media formats. This method is commonly employed in films, television shows, video games, and advertisements to convey information, enhance storytelling, or provide character voices. The voice over artist typically records their lines in a studio, ensuring high-quality audio that can be seamlessly integrated into the final product.

Types of Voice Over
There are several types of voice over, each serving different purposes. Commercial voice over is used in advertisements to promote products or services, while character voice over is prevalent in animated films and video games, where actors bring characters to life. Additionally, narration voice over is often used in educational content, audiobooks, and corporate videos, providing a clear and informative delivery of information.
Voice Over Techniques
Voice over artists employ various techniques to enhance their performances. These include modulation of tone, pitch, and pace to convey different emotions and maintain listener engagement. Additionally, effective breathing techniques and articulation are essential for delivering clear and impactful lines. Understanding the nuances of voice over can significantly improve the quality of the final audio product.
Technology in Voice Over
The advancement of technology has transformed the voice over industry. With the rise of digital audio workstations (DAWs), artists can record, edit, and produce high-quality audio from the comfort of their homes. Furthermore, artificial intelligence (AI) is beginning to play a role in voice over, with tools that can generate synthetic voices for various applications, although the human touch remains irreplaceable in many contexts.
